As an HVAC/Duct Cleaning Technician at a SERVPRO of Lake County, you will play a key role in improving indoor air quality for homes and businesses by inspecting, cleaning, and restoring duct systems to ensure optimal performance. You will be part of a team committed to making property damage "Like it never even happened®," while providing exceptional customer service and adhering to industry standards.
Key Responsibilities
  • Perform HVAC and Duct Cleaning Services: Conduct thorough inspections and clean air ducts, vents, and HVAC systems using industry-standard equipment such as vacuums, compressors, and rotary brushes.
  • Job Site Management: Prepare rooms and set up containment/safety measures and equipment for each project, ensuring the job site is clean and orderly during and after service.
  • Equipment Maintenance: Operate, clean, and maintain tools, equipment, and assigned company vehicles, managing inventory of supplies as needed.
  • Documentation and Communication: Complete work orders and job file documentation accurately, including before/after photos. Communicate clearly and professionally with customers to explain services and address any questions or concerns.
  • Safety and Compliance: Ensure all work is performed safely, following SERVPRO, OSHA, and National Air Duct Cleaners Association (NADCA) standards.
  • Team Support: Collaborate with management and other technicians to maintain efficient production processes and assist with other cleaning or restoration services when required.
Qualifications and Skills
  • Experience: Experience in duct cleaning, HVAC, or the restoration industry is required.
  • Technical Skills: Basic knowledge of HVAC systems and airflow principles is a plus.
  • Certifications: NADCA or IICRC certifications are preferred, but not required.
  • Physical Ability:
    • Ability to lift a minimum of 50 lbs regularly, occasionally up to 100 lbs with assistance.
    • Comfortable working in confined spaces (attics, crawl spaces) and at various heights (climbing ladders).
    • Ability to stand, walk, squat, and use hands/tools for extended periods.
  • Soft Skills: Strong attention to detail, excellent customer service, problem-solving skills, and the ability to work independently or as part of a team.
  • Requirements:
    • High school diploma or equivalent.
    • Valid driver's license with a clean driving record.
